Description
Current advances in technology have driven forward the harnessing of waste biomass for alternative fuels to help and protect our environment by decreasing our dependence on fossil fuels. Bioenergy: Process, Technology and Viability provides a broad overview of the subject, focusing on the mechanisms of different waste to energy technologies (WTE), rather than giving detailed explanation of each and every process. The authors have taken care to include most recent WTE process in this text book. This book covers all types of biomass resources on a global scale, making it unique. One way of using energy efficiently is to use biomass in biorefineries and methods used for energy conversion has been discussed in detail with engineered diagrams. The problem with biomass to bioenergy is cost, hence in this book techno economic consideration for different WTE process were described in detail. This book highlights and elucidates challenges in biorefineries, key issues and socio economic problems faced by WTE. This book will provide facts and discussion to professionals, scientist, and students as as well as to those working for various government and private bodies.
